It is the last over of the cricket match, with India requiring 17 runs to win against Australia.

In his two-bedroom house situated in main Mumbai, a middle-aged man is viewing the game, nervously. He's sitting on the edge of his grey colour sofa with his cellphone glued to his right-hand man.


He has made more than 10 contact the last 30 minutes - not to talk about the match however to keep revising his bet.


Five minutes previously his cash was on Australia, but now as the Indian batsman prepares to deal with the last over he's altered his mind.


"I believe India is winning, make the modification," he tells his bookmaker on the phone.


And a few minutes later on his prediction comes real, as India wins the match in a nail-biting finish.


"I have made $200 today," he says with a childish glee.


For more than 3 years he's been banking on cricket matches. We can't expose his name as what he's doing is unlawful in India.


Other than horse racing, sports betting of any kind is not enabled in India. Despite that, prohibited wagering syndicates thrive in the country.


'Black money'


According to the Doha-based International Centre for sports betting Security, India's unlawful sports betting market deserves some $150bn a year. And much of that gambling money is directed towards cricket.


With no legal avenue, punters position bets utilizing their phones by making calls to bookmakers. Gamblers can bank on anything related to the cricket match, from who is winning to the greatest individual run scorer.


Most of these deals include so-called "black money", which is money not declared to the taxman.


The 1867 Public Gambling Act bars any kind of sports betting in India, however unlike in the US which has a law prohibiting web sports betting, there is nothing comparable here.


And overseas wagering companies are utilizing this loophole to draw Indians. Even though there are no online sports betting operators based out of India, a lot individuals have actually signed up accounts with offshore companies.


"Legally you can escape [with this], as the law is ambiguous for online sports betting," states Mumbai- based lawyer HP Ranina.


But despite this, it is "offline gambling", done through phone calls which control the market.


Calls for legalisation


The clamour to legalise wagering in cricket has grown after a panel designated by India's Supreme Court proposed the concept, stating it would assist secure down on corruption in the country's favourite sport.


The Justice RM Lodha Commission was set up to recommend modifications in the functioning of India's cricket regulative body, the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I), after the 2013 Indian Premier League sports betting scandal came to light.


Two franchises have actually been banned for 2 years after some players and group officials were condemned of fixing parts of the match at the request of bookmakers.

The panel likewise argues that legalised wagering will bring in tax profits for the exchequer that might amount to $2bn a year.


Even gamblers feel that legalising sports betting is a move in the ideal instructions.


"I do not mind paying some cash out my revenues, as long as I can gamble publicly," states our cricket bettor.


It would also open a substantial organization chance for licensed bookmakers and worldwide online sports betting companies to establish operations in India.


And it would help limit match repairing in cricket and other sports betting, argue numerous, by helping make deals involved in sports betting more transparent.


"If you work alongside wagering business, you will have a really reliable approach of stamping out match fixing," states George Oborne, who runs a mock wagering site, India Bet.


But lots of also think, that the taxes levied on the gambler and the bookie will need to be reasonable to make it attractive enough for them to gamble legally.


However, there are limitations.


"Definitely there will be illegal sports betting because (some) individuals would not desire to leave an audit path by entering the white market," states Mr Oborne.


He adds that people who utilize unaccounted money to position huge bets will never ever bet lawfully.


Approval concern


For sports betting gambling to be legalised, parliamentary approval will be required to create a new law, and politically this will be a hard idea to offer.


"Although lots of people are involved in some sort of gambling - it's still a controversial concern for many," says our unnamed punter.


And considered that India has a federal structural - each state will have to likewise pass a different law to legalise sports betting gambling in their area.

"The procedure is so long and tricky that it will take years," says Mr Ranina."That's why, we are cynical about this becoming a truth anytime soon."


Yet with the concept having been backed by an official panel for the very first time, a minimum of an argument has fired up around a subject - which previously was considered a taboo.
